Output ec0de2390f69553e4f0edf0b00ed7619003532d7a7c1ac18d70eb5b838eadc93:10

value
5167972
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c5ccfdb9675ef3a8af91301e6198b960fa9e04e OP_EQUAL
address
3QhPPa8MgdyqPb2SpLuJvm2fFDp43qhuoh
transaction
ec0de2390f69553e4f0edf0b00ed7619003532d7a7c1ac18d70eb5b838eadc93